Функциональность замены или добавления данных присутствует в датасетах, созданных из файлового источника:
Для перехода в настройки замены или добавления данных необходимо в разделе «Колонки» нажать на текстовую кнопку
. После нажатия откроется блок с настройками:
|
Данный блок состоит из следующих элементов:
На данном этапе необходимо выбрать тип файла, из которого в дальнейшем будут загружаться данные для замены или добавления. Для выбора типа файла необходимо кликнуть по полю «Выберите тип файла», откроется список:
|
Данный список состоит из следующих типов файлов:
Данный этап обязателен для заполнения, так как следующие этапы будут активированы только после указания типа файла.
При замене данных структура датасета может не совпадать со структурой файла (под структурой понимается - состав колонок и/или тип данных колонок):
Для замены данных в датасете необходимо в блоке «Замена данных» нажать на кнопку
, откроется модальное окно проводника для выбора файла. После обработки выбранного файла будет произведен переход в окно преднастроек замены данных:
|
В данном окне отображается предварительный просмотр таблицы файла.
Замена данных производится слева направо, где первая колонка файла заменяет данные первой колонки датасета и т. д. Если система обнаруживает несоответствие типов данных в колонке файла, они автоматически приводятся к формату данных соответствующей колонки датасета согласно правилам приведения типов данных, но только в том случае, если это логически допустимо. Например, строку "1" можно преобразовать в число, а строку "текст" - нельзя.
|
В случае если автоматическое приведение типов данных невозможно, пользователю предлагается привести данные к нужному типу вручную. Для замены данных в файле нужно нажать на кнопку "Изменить".
|
Если файл содержит больше колонок, чем датасет, в окне преднастройки отображается предупреждение. Если оставить включенным чек-бокс "Добавить колонки из файла в датасет", они будут добавлены. Добавление не затрагивает расчетные колонки.
|
Если файл содержит меньше колонок, чем датасет, в окне преднастройки также отображается предупреждение. При продолжении процедуры замены "лишние" колонки в датасете будут удалены. Удаление не затрагивает расчетные колонки.
|
При нажатии на кнопку "Далее" отображается окно предпросмотра загружаемых данных.
|
При нажатии на кнопку:
Для добавления данных в датасет необходимо в блоке «Добавление данных» нажать на кнопку
, откроется модальное окно проводника для выбора файла. После обработки выбранного файла будет произведен переход в окно преднастроек добавления данных:
|
В окне настроек добавления данных отображается предварительный просмотр датасета. По умолчанию данные файла будут добавлены к данным датасета снизу и строго слева направо. Поведение при большем/меньшем числе колонок аналогично поведению при замене данных датасета.
При нажатии на кнопку "Далее" отображается окно предпросмотра загружаемых данных:
|
При нажатии на кнопку: